Understanding Manual Handling
What is Hand-operated Handling?
Manual handling refers to any type of activity that includes the lifting, bring, pressing, pulling, or supporting of loads making use of human stamina. This task can occur in many sectors such as healthcare, building and construction, logistics, and retail. As uncomplicated as it sounds, inappropriate manual handling can lead to severe injuries.
Why is Guidebook Handling Important?
Proper handbook taking care of methods are essential for numerous factors:
- Injury Avoidance: One of the most considerable reason is injury avoidance. Inaccurate lifting methods can cause musculoskeletal problems (MSDs), back pain, pressures, and various other serious injuries. Efficiency: Effective hand-operated handling converts right into better efficiency. When employees use right methods to lift and move products securely, they can function quicker without risking their health. Legal Compliance: Many countries have policies pertaining to safe training practices. Employers should comply with these regulations to prevent penalties.

Basic Concepts of Raising Safely
When it comes down to Click here for more it, there are basic principles every staff member ought to adhere to:
Assess the tons before you lift it. Position your feet shoulder-width apart for stability. Bend at your knees rather than your waist; keep your back directly while lifting.Advanced Lifting Techniques
For much heavier loads or awkward shapes, consider these innovative approaches:
- Use group training techniques where 2 or even more people share the load. Utilize mechanical help such as forklifts or raises whenever possible.
